Out of curiosity - are these bugs in quicklens, or how are the macros checked? |
|
They are macro related. In practice this means, that they break some invariants about the generated code, to it could potentially cause bugs for some edge cases. Though, IMHO it is probably very unlikely for the second one to cause any bugs. |
The trouble is once any macro library used in the project causes -Xcheck-macros failures, it is quite difficult to check the rest of the project. I was motivated to open this by the fact my project is crashing with 3.7.0 because of some macro bug in https://github.com/OpenGrabeso/light-surface/. |
